Free Show!Preston McCabe is a country singer and songwriter from a small town in Indiana. He has been performing since he was 14, and believes in bringing back the traditional country sound. Preston brings a genuine and spirited performance to every stage, drawing on influences from traditional country and his own life on the rodeo circuit.
His biggest role models are Waylon Jennings, George Jones, Alan Jackson, George Strait, Chris Ledoux, and most of all his grandpa.
Preston puts on a lively, honky tonkin show that keeps the crowd engaged; while never failing to keep the story telling aspect of country music alive.
Preston has also opened for multi-platinum artist Josh Turner, as well as country music legends Shenandoah; the GRAMMY-winning group behind the timeless hit “Two Dozen Roses.” Preston's shows allow him to connect with longtime fans of classic country while introducing his spirited sound to new audiences.
